Plateau Senator, ID Gyang invokes Presidential order against resurging attacks

The Senator representing Plateau North in the Nigerian National Assembly, Istifanus Gyang has asked law enforcements to “quickly” track down those attacking communities in Plateau State.
“President Buhari recently gave an order to the Military and Police to ensure that all bloodthirsty bandits across the nation are done away with.
“The STF and the Police should quickly enforce the Presidential order to arrest violent attacks on peace-loving citizens and communities in Plateau North,” said the Senator.
Gyang, the Deputy Senate Committee Chairman in a press statement signed by his Media and Protocol Officer, Mr. Musa Ashoms, condemned Tuesday’s killing of two people in Rubong Hamlet of Foron village, in Plateau’s Barkin Ladi Local Government Area.
The ‘criminals’ who rustled 100 cows and 120 sheep after killing the villagers are “enemies of peace and peaceful coexistence”, he said.
In his words, “Peaceful coexistence does not admit of crime and criminality. Criminals and bandits who trade in crime and bloodshed must face the wrath of the law so that the lives and property of law abiding citizens can be secured.”
While assuring of his resolve to secure, reconcile and empower his constituents, the lawmaker asked villagers” to be very vigilant against criminals and bandits whose actions constitute a threat to peace and peaceful coexistence.”
